Sahar Dolatshahi
Born: 1979-10-08
• Tehran, Iran
Sahar Dolatshahi is an actress who was born in 1979 in Tehran, Iran. She started her career in cinema and starred in “Fireworks Wednesday” directed by Asghar Farhadi in 2005. She has won the Crystal Simorgh for Best Supporting Actress for Mostafa Kiaei’s “Ice Age” and “Istanbul Junction” and “The Cold Sweat” by Soheil Beiraghi. From her notable activities, “Mim Mesle Madar” by Rasoul Molagholipour, “Gold and Copper” by Homayoun Assadian and “Mastaneh” by Hossein Farahbakhsh can be named.
